Review the history of how the Czech town of Terezin became the Theresienstadt Ghetto. This lesson is the perfect precursor to students completing the Butterfly Project - an amazing lesson from the Houston Holocaust Museum that uses poetry and artwork created by children in the Theresienstadt Ghetto to inspire students to create butterflies representing the children lost during the Holocaust.
